After the Tollywood game changer blockbuster Arjun Reddy, hero Vijay Deverakonda returns on silver screen almost after a year, with Geetha Govindam costarring sandalwood babe Rashmika Mandanna, and directed by Parasuram who had last delivered Srirasth Subhamasthu. Here's team AP Herald's exclusive first on net Geetha Govindam first report.



The film begins with Govind (Vijay Deverakonda) narrating his love story to Nithya Menen who makes a surprise cameo, and he explains how he fell in love with Geetha (Rashmika Mandanna). Govind is a lecturer in a college and as he falls in love with Geetha, tries hard to woo her. Situations lead to misunderstandings, but somehow soon, Geetha also falls for him, but now its Govind's turn to reject marriage proposal with Geetha, What happened to the lead pair, and if they united or not is what Geetha Govindam is all about.



Vijay Deverakonda is impressive as the innocent faced lover boy, and Rashmika is top notch with  her beautiful performance. The chemistry between the lead pair is the lifeline of the movie, and Parasuram makes the best use of it while also presenting an engaging screenplay with the right proportion of love, sentiments and twists. Aided by Gopi Sunder's lovely music, Parasuram delivers a winner, and Vijay Deverakonda and Rashmika strike gold again with Geetha Govindam.
